    Bybit Georgia Makes a Strong Debut at DGFI 2025 and Announces Partnership with Setanta Sports

    The crypto exchange expands its local presence through sports collaboration and innovation

    Bybit Georgia, licensed by the National Bank of Georgia as a VASP and part of the global Bybit ecosystem, made its official debut at the DeGameFi 2025 conference in Tbilisi. Alongside showcasing its services, the company announced a strategic partnership with Setanta Sports, one of the leading broadcasters in the country.

    This marked the company’s first major public appearance since launching in July 2025. The DGFI 2025 conference gathered over 5,000 participants, including crypto professionals, regulators, and media representatives.

    The Bybit Georgia booth attracted significant attention from attendees. Mazurka Zeng, the head of Fiat and Payments at Bybit, joined a high-profile discussion panel with representatives from Mastercard, Tether, and the National Bank of Georgia. The panel explored the intersection of digital finance, blockchain, and artificial intelligence, emphasizing Georgia’s growing role in the Web3 space.

    “We’re thrilled to be part of DeGameFi 2025 — our first public engagement in Georgia since the launch of Bybit Georgia in July,” said Zeng. “The event helped us build new partnerships and strengthen our presence in this rapidly evolving crypto ecosystem. Georgia holds a unique place in Bybit’s global strategy. Our mission is to make crypto accessible to everyone through trust, innovation, and education.”

    Partnership with Setanta Sports: Reaching the Mass Audience

    Bybit Georgia revealed a strategic collaboration with Setanta Sports, the country’s top sports broadcaster with more than 2.5 million monthly viewers. This marks the company’s first large-scale local partnership.

    Setanta Sports broadcasts major global sporting events and has a strong foothold in Georgia’s media landscape. According to Bybit Georgia representatives, this collaboration aims to increase brand awareness and educate the public about cryptocurrencies through accessible media exposure.

    To kick off the initiative, the two companies launched a joint campaign with a prize pool of 80,000 USDT.

    Strengthening Local Presence and Crypto Education

    Since entering the market in July 2025, Bybit Georgia has achieved several milestones aimed at solidifying its local presence:

    • Mobile app release: In October, the company launched its mobile app featuring one-click crypto purchases.
    • Educational initiatives: In partnership with Pixel Academy, Bybit introduced the “Crypto Lion” course to enhance Web3 literacy among young people.
    • Industry engagement: Participation in DGFI 2025 reinforced Bybit Georgia’s role as an active contributor to the national digital asset ecosystem.
    • Media partnerships: The collaboration with Setanta Sports highlights Bybit’s commitment to reaching a wider, mainstream audience through trusted media.

    Bybit stated that its expansion into Georgia followed the company’s regulatory approval under the European MiCA framework. The exchange remains the only global crypto platform fully licensed by the National Bank of Georgia, emphasizing its long-term goal to build trust, drive innovation, and foster education within the regional crypto space.
